Arrow Riding Centre for the Disabled The Arrow Riding Centre is for young people and adults with special needs. We are a friendly, volunteer-run charity located in Dartford Kent.

Our team of qualified instructors work with our physiotherapists to develop tailor-made programmes for each of our riders, helping them to unlock their potential on and off the horse.

This is Khianna and Baline riding their B1 walk test. Baline is a superstar having been at Arrow for many years but she is relatively new to competition having only started her competition career within the last 5 years. She really is a complete legend of a pony and knows her job perfectly! Khianna is completely blind and has to put so much trust into Baline and rely on her other senses to be able to get round a test. Khi rode with Bradbourne RDA before coming to Arrow so has been to the Nationals before but this is her first time with Baline. Baline likes to test Khi during training and all of this has helped Khi to really get to know Baline and enable her to ride such a fantastic test to become a national champion! For those that ride, try riding blindfolded and see how difficult this is - Khi, this is awe inspiring and we are so proud of you! 💙

This is Ella and Rosa riding their grade 6 walk dressage test at the nationals. This is Rosa's second time taking part in a dressage test away from home - her first was in May at the regionals so we a super proud of how well Rosa coped in such a big atmosphere with so much going on. Rosa is very green (needs more education in horsey terms!) and this is mostly due to the issues she had with her tooth a few years ago. But despite this, Ella done such a fantastic job with Rosa. Ella has Cerebral Palsy so Rosa isn't always easy for her and those that know Rosa, will know that if you do not tell her exactly what you want her to do at every step, Rosa will quite often do what she thinks is the right thing 🤦🏼‍♀️. We are amazed they stayed in the white boards and so pleased Rosa didn't think joining someone else's dressage test was a better idea (for the horsey people, she's a Welsh so you will understand!)🤣. The amount of dedication Ella has to her riding and understanding of Rosa is a testament to itself and Rosa has definitely helped Ella's confidence and belief in herself. We are so proud of you Ella! 💙

RDA National Championships done for another year and what a brilliant time we had! This is a long one!

Baline and Rosa were absolute superstars the entire time, perfectly behaved throughout - how lucky are we to have such amazing ponies! They have definitely earned a well deserved break. It was so hot at Hartpury so lots of hosing down for the ponies to make sure they were comfortable - even Val joined in with being hosed off by the end of the day 🤣. Along with electrolytes in their daily feeds since the start of the hot weather and riding them at home gently to prepare them for riding in the heat. It all paid off because our ponies were super comfortable and happy throughout. Not forgetting the very early starts to arrive at Hartpury and leave to come home so we could beat the heat and travel the ponies comfortably.
